Criminal Justice and Corrections at Parkland College

Ranked 135th of 343 associate programs in Criminal Justice and Corrections by 5-year earnings.

Median · 1 year out
$35,198
middle 50%: $25,437 – $48,585
Median · 5 years out
$51,828
middle 50%: $36,732 – $65,371
Median · 10 years out
$57,301
middle 50%: $40,478 – $73,099

Criminal Justice associates earn a median of $35k in year one. Salary growth reaches $57k by the tenth year.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
